English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
Метод Date.parse() принимает строку даты (например, "Jul 30, 1992") и возвращает количество миллисекунд с полуночи 1 января 1970 года.
Эта функция очень полезна для установки даты по строковому значению, например, в сочетании с методом setTime() и объектом Date.
Поскольку parse() является статическим методом Date, вы всегда должны использовать его как Date.parse().
Date.parse(dateString)
var d = Date.parse("July 30, 1992");Проверьте тест <›/›
Все браузеры полностью поддерживают метод parse():
Метод | |||||
parse() | Это | Это | Это | Это | Это |
Параметр | Описание |
---|---|
dateString | Строка, представляющая дату |
Возвратное значение: | Миллисекунды с полуночи 1 января 1970 года |
---|---|
Версия JavaScript: | ECMAScript 1 |
Рассчитать количество лет с 1 января 1970 года до 30 июля 1992 года:
function myFunc() { var d = Date.parse("July 30, 1992"); var minutes = 1000 * 60; var hours = minutes * 60; var days = hours * 24; var years = days * 365; var ans = Math.round(d / years); document.getElementById('result').innerHTML = ans; }Проверьте тест <›/›